
## 工作流概述
这个n8n工作流构建了一个端到端的AI驱动招聘管道,使用Airtable、OpenAI和Google Drive来自动化候选人筛选流程。
## 目标用户
这个工作流非常适合:
– 人力资源专业人员和招聘人员,希望自动化和增强招聘流程
– 寻求AI驱动、一致性和数据支持的候选人评估的组织
– 使用Airtable作为招聘数据库的招聘经理
## 解决的问题
手动筛选候选人耗时、不一致且难以扩展。这个工作流通过以下方式解决这些问题:
– 自动化简历接收和AI评估
– 动态匹配候选人与职位发布
– 生成标准化的适合性报告
– 仅在候选人符合条件时通知HR
– 将所有申请存储在结构化的Airtable数据库中
## 工作流程详细步骤
### 步骤1:候选人申请表单
– 通过公共Web表单接受候选人申请,包括简历上传(仅限PDF)
– 收集完整候选人信息:全名、邮箱地址、申请职位、相关技能、求职信
### 步骤2:简历处理
– 从上传的简历中提取文本进行处理
– 将简历存储在Google Drive中并生成可共享链接
### 步骤3:职位匹配
– 将申请与存储在Airtable中的职位发布进行匹配
– 使用AI(通过OpenAI GPT-4)根据职位描述和要求评估候选人
### 步骤4:AI评估
– 生成适合性结果,包括:
– 匹配百分比
– 筛选状态:适合、不适合、待审核
– 详细说明
### 步骤5:数据整合与存储
– 将AI输出和文件合并到一个数据对象中
– 在Airtable中创建包含所有申请数据的新候选人记录
### 步骤6:自动通知
– 如果候选人被标记为”适合”,通过Gmail自动通知HR
## 技术节点组成
工作流包含以下核心节点:
– **Candidate Application Form**: 收集候选人申请信息的Web表单
– **Extract Resume PDF**: 从PDF简历中提取文本内容
– **Upload File**: 将简历上传到Google Drive
– **Set File Permission**: 设置文件权限为公开可读
– **Search Job Posting**: 在Airtable中搜索匹配的职位发布
– **Candidate Screener AI Agent**: 使用OpenAI GPT-4评估候选人适合性
– **OpenAI Chat Model**: 提供AI模型支持
– **Structured Output Parser**: 结构化输出解析器
– **Merge**: 合并数据流
– **Create Candidate**: 在Airtable中创建候选人记录
– **Check if candidate is suitable**: 检查候选人是否适合
– **Send email to HR**: 向HR发送通知邮件
## 设置要求
– 复制Airtable基础模板
– 设置Google Drive文件夹
– 连接OpenAI API密钥用于AI代理模型
– 连接Gmail账户用于邮件通知
– 部署面向公众的表单以开始接收申请
## 自定义扩展
– **扩展文件支持**: 通过添加格式转换节点允许DOC或DOCX上传
– **添加多收件人邮件提醒**: 扩展Gmail节点以支持多个HR收件人
– **处理”待审核”状态**: 添加额外逻辑来通知或标记这些候选人
– **自动发送拒绝邮件**: 为”不适合”的候选人扩展IF分支
– **安排面试**: 与Google Calendar或Calendly API集成
– **添加Slack通知**: 向团队频道发送实时更新提醒

评论(0)